What Is a VPS and How It Works
A VPS (Virtual Private Server) is a virtual server that simulates a physical dedicated server within a shared infrastructure. Through virtualization technology, a single powerful physical server is divided into several completely independent virtual servers, each with guaranteed resources and total isolation from the others.
Imagine a large building (the physical server) divided into independent apartments (the VPS). Each apartment has its own utilities, keys and private spaces. Even though the building is shared, each tenant (VPS user) has their own reserved space with guaranteed resources and no interference from neighbors.
How Virtualization Works
We use Proxmox VE with KVM (Kernel-based Virtual Machine) technology to create our VPS. This enterprise-grade solution guarantees:
- Complete isolation: Each VPS operates as an independent server with its own Linux kernel
- Guaranteed resources: Assigned CPU, RAM and storage are not shared with other VPS
- Native performance: KVM offers performance almost identical to a dedicated physical server
- Security: Isolation at hypervisor level prevents issues on one VPS from affecting the others

VPS vs Shared Hosting vs Dedicated Server: Which to Choose?
To help you understand if a VPS is the right solution for you, let’s compare it with the other options available.
Shared Hosting
Shared hosting is the entry-level solution where hundreds of websites share the same server resources. It is cheap (3–10€/month) but has significant limits:
- Non-guaranteed resources: If other sites on the server consume many resources, your site slows down
- Limited control: You can only use the provided control panel (cPanel, Plesk), with no root access
- Reduced customization: You cannot install custom software or change server configurations
- Shared security: A security issue on one site can potentially affect the others
Ideal for: Showcase sites, personal blogs, projects with a very limited budget and minimal traffic.
VPS (Virtual Private Server)
The VPS offers the best balance between performance, control and cost. You get guaranteed resources and full control at a fraction of the cost of a dedicated server:
- Guaranteed resources: Dedicated CPU, RAM and storage that no one else can use
- Full root access: Total control to install any software and change any configuration
- Total isolation: Stable performance regardless of the other VPS on the same hardware
- Scalability: Possibility to upgrade when needs grow
- Affordable cost: Our VPS start from just 5€/month
Ideal for: High-traffic websites, e-commerce, web applications, development environments, databases, game servers, VoIP PBXs.
Dedicated Server
A dedicated server is a physical server entirely reserved for you. It offers the highest possible performance but at a significantly higher cost:
- Maximum resources: All the power of the physical server is yours
- Physical isolation: No hardware sharing with other users
- Hardware customization: Possibility to configure custom hardware specifications
- High cost: Typically 50–200€/month or more
Ideal for: Mission-critical enterprise applications, workloads that require more than 16 vCPU and 64GB RAM, compliance requirements that demand full physical isolation.

1. Guaranteed Resources vs Over-allocation
Some providers practice overallocation: they sell more resources than physically available, betting that not all customers will use them at the same time. This leads to unpredictable and degraded performance at peak times.

2. Type of Storage: HDD vs SSD vs NVMe
Storage is often the performance bottleneck. The difference is huge:
- HDD: Slow (100–150 IOPS), obsolete for modern VPS
- SATA SSD: Good (10,000–20,000 IOPS), standard for budget VPS
- NVMe: Excellent (100,000+ IOPS), the professional standard

NVMe Storage in RAID10
Storage is often the performance bottleneck. We use only NVMe disks in RAID10 configuration to maximize both performance and reliability.
What is NVMe? NVMe (Non-Volatile Memory Express) is a communication protocol optimized for SSDs that uses the PCIe interface instead of SATA. This removes bottlenecks and allows performance 5–10 times higher than SATA SSD.
What is RAID10? RAID10 combines mirroring (RAID1) and striping (RAID0) to achieve both high performance and redundancy. Data is duplicated across multiple disks: even if a disk fails, the data remains accessible without interruptions and the disk is hot-swapped.
Advantages of NVMe RAID10:
- Exceptional performance: Over 100,000 IOPS (Input/Output Operations Per Second)
- Minimal latency: <100 microseconds per operation
- Redundancy: Protection against hardware failures without downtime
- Reliability: Hot disk replacement without service interruption

Self-Service Migration
If you have experience, you can migrate on your own:
- Full backup: Create backups of files, databases, configurations on the current server
- Activate new VPS: Choose the configuration and activate the VPS
- Install software: Install the required stack (LAMP, LEMP, etc.)
- Transfer data: Use rsync, scp or FTP to transfer files
- Import databases: Import SQL dumps of databases
- Configure: Adapt configurations to the new environment
- Test: Test the site using /etc/hosts or temporary DNS
- DNS switch: Change DNS to point to the new server
- Monitoring: Monitor for 24–48 hours to ensure everything works

Horizontal Upgrade (Scaling Out)
For very high workloads, you can implement distributed architectures with multiple VPS:
- Load balancing: Frontend VPS with load balancer (HAProxy, Nginx) that distributes traffic to multiple backend VPS
- Separate database: VPS dedicated to the database (MySQL, PostgreSQL) separate from web servers
- Microservices: Microservice architecture with VPS dedicated to each service
- Caching layer: VPS dedicated to Redis/Memcached
- CDN origin: VPS as origin for CDN (Cloudflare, Fastly)
